Iron

Iron helps your body carry oxygen to the cells. It plays a significant role in many immune system processes. It comes in different forms. The human body can more easily absorb heme iron (i.e., iron from animal products), which is found in:

  • Chicken.
  • Red meat (limit the frequency to less often and in smaller amounts).
  • Turkey.
  • Oysters.
  • Sardines.
  • Clams.
  • Mussels.
  • Light tuna.

If you’re a vegetarian, have no fear. You can still find iron in:

  • Beans.
  • Broccoli.
  • Kale.
  • Iron-fortified cereals.

Selenium

Being essential for preventing infections Selenium seems to have a powerful effect on the immune system. Animal foods are the best sources, with the exception of Brazil nuts, which offer a whopping more significant than 100% daily value in one nut. So a few of these in a day may be sufficient. Selenium can be found in:

  • Seafood (tuna, halibut, sardines).
  • Meat and liver.
  • Poultry.
  • Cottage cheese.

Zinc

Zinc is a vital component for the production of new immune system cells. It is found primarily in animal foods but can also be found in some vegetarian food. Some sources include:

  • Oysters.
  • Crab.
  • Lean meats and poultry.
  • Baked beans.
  • Yogurt.
  • Chickpeas.

How to grocery shop to increase your immunity

The basic rule can help you when selecting fruits and vegetables at the grocery store  – the more colorful the vegetables and fruits, the better. Dull fruits and vegetables tend to have lost some of their nutrients. Get fresh ones every time if possible.

A variety of fruits and vegetables from every color of the rainbow ensure that you are getting sufficient health-boosting nutrients and vitamins. Your plate will also be more appealing to look at anyway.

It is also significant to know that you build a robust immune system by upholding healthy eating habits over time.

Do supplements help your immunity?

Even though the most recommended way to absorb essential nutrients is to get them from food directly, sometimes we find our bodies struggling to keep up with the daily intake of nutrients required. It follows then our immune systems may suffer leaving us prone to illness.

That is when a superior quality supplement and vitamins can help make up and bring your levels up to help restore your body’s immune system back to normal.

In normal circumstances when your body is functioning as it should, it absorbs and better makes use of vitamins and minerals which come from your dietary sources.

However, should you decide to use a supplement or multivitamin to up your levels, always make sure to research a bit more about the supplement itself and the company producing it before purchasing just to make sure you are getting value for money.

Some supplements may have side effects, specifically if taken before surgery or with other medicines. Supplements can cause problems if you suffer from some health conditions.  Most supplements haven’t been tested in children, pregnant women, and other vulnerable groups.  So always do your own due diligence and find a superior tested and approved quality ‘multinutrient’ supplement.

Always remember the quality and efficacy of the supplement are the most important factors to consider before buying any supplement.

If you are on medication, it is essential to avoid taking supplements which may interfere with your medication. Supplements whose scientific research is questionable are also not the best to purchase.

For those on medication, it is always wise to seek the advice of your doctor or other certified healthcare professional.
